摘要
2-Furfuraldehyde, 5-hydroxymethylfurfuraldehyde and malonaldehyde are known to react with 2-thiobarbituric acid when heated in an acidic medium. A study of the influence of several chemical and physico-chemical variables on the reaction was undertaken. The products of reaction show high absorption in the visible spectral region with several degrees of overlapping. The resolution of ternary mixtures of these compounds was accomplished by several chemometric approaches. A comparative study of the results obtained for simultaneous determinations in mixtures by using derivative spectrophotometry and partial least-squares analysis is presented. The multi-wavelength factor analysis-based method is demonstrated to be the method of choice for the multi-component analysis of ternary mixtures of these compounds.
